Robert Zemeckis, director of the film, he met his partner Bob Gale - with who had already made "I Want to Hold Your Hand" (1978) and "Used Cars" (1980) - and also recruited Steven Spielberg - with whom he had worked on "1941" (1979) - to bring this idea to big screen. Along with Gale - who was a great experience as a writer - wrote the script and Spielberg, who already had several contacts in Hollywood after his successes as "Jaws," "ET" and "Indiana Jones", the tape was initially going to be starring Eric Stoltz. And this "beginning" of Stoltz lasted 5 weeks of filming, including scenes that are starring in a classic film in the , but Zemeckis never convinced him to his comic style and asking permission for the production decided to change by the young Michael J. Fox who was then starring as blocks of the set the film "Teen Wolf" (1985). The resemblance to Stoltz was notorious for what is not overly complicated in the treatment of the film, despite the charisma that gave Michael was full of like Zemeckis who gave the "we" convinced he had finally found the ideal protagonist. Michael J.

Fox led the cast in which other figures were also present, but their names were not the basis of the tape - as often happens today - but their work was part of a work that is now recognized and is remembered with joy.
